Transaction 0f1796253cc509751266da27540577a52ca1875e88430905db3b42226a54cb87
1 Input
1 Output
-
0f1796253cc509751266da27540577a52ca1875e88430905db3b42226a54cb87:0
- value
- 18988878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 425e4180694266aac776f237af9077b1842f8c8c OP_EQUAL
- address
- 37jwSDXy6coYcipesEUFaYG2zUByU29pgm